Ashley Roberts is 'heartbroken' following the death of her friend, as she joined a host of celebrities paying emotional tributes.
The Heart radio presenter, 42, took to Instagram to share singer-songwriter Bobby Newberry's devastating post about the loss of his beloved husband Anthony "T.J" Paradise. Ashley commented on the post: "Our poor T.J. Heartbroken," accompanied by a heart, wings and a praying hands emoji.
Bobby also shared a heartfelt message for his partner of 20 years, alongside a black and white photo of the late star from his hospital bed. His emotional statement read: "With the heaviest heart I have to let everyone know that my beautiful husband T.J. lost his four year battle with cancer on 5/4/24.
"e was surrounded by loved ones and even in this dark time there was so much light and love in the room. If you met him even once you knew how much of an impact he had on the world around him. Nothing will ever be the same.
I had twenty and a half years of love and memories and now I have a lifetime of missing you. I love you, my sweetheart." Ashley responded with a touching comment, writing: "Can't believe it. He will be forever loved.
May he spread his wings. I love you so much Swiss." She added: "Love you both so much. I'm so so sorry." Drag Race’s Michelle Visage also said: "Ohhhhh Bobby I have no words.
Sorry doesn’t cover it. You are both embedded in each others lives forever with so much love.” Modern Family actress Sarah Hyland commented, saying: "Oh Bobby. Heartbroken.
Sending all my love your way. He was such a beautiful light with an incredible heart. I love you so much." Actress Ashley Tisdale also shared her sympathy for the star, “My heart is broken.
